Ergebnis 1 bis 3 von 3

Thema: Suche dringend eine Liste der Formulartypen und deren Abbildung in der Datenbank

  1. #1
    Contao-Nutzer Avatar von Piet
    Registriert seit
    25.06.2009.
    Ort
    Bergisches Land
    Beiträge
    122
    Partner-ID
    ex5879

    Standard Suche dringend eine Liste der Formulartypen und deren Abbildung in der Datenbank

    Hallo


    Ich bin dabei ein umfangreiches Formular zu erstellen, welches die Daten direkt in einer Tabelle der DB ablegen soll. (Formulardaten speichern)
    Für jedes Feld muss ich dazu ja eine Spalte anlegen.

    Aber für welchen Feldtyp muss ich welchen Datentyp in der Tabelle vorsehen?

    Für die meisten dürften Varchars gehen, aber was braucht man bei Radiobutton oder Selectmenü oder Checkboxmenü oder Kalenderfeld?

    Ich habe schon im Wiki gestöbert , aber nichts gefunden?

    Piet
    Mein Motto: Hilf Deinen Kunden zu wachsen, dann wächst auch Du.
    Bei Interesse: Piet ist zu finden unter Webdesign-NRW.de

  2. #2
    Contao-Nutzer Avatar von Piet
    Registriert seit
    25.06.2009.
    Ort
    Bergisches Land
    Beiträge
    122
    Partner-ID
    ex5879

    Standard

    Hallo

    Ich habe über IRC contao.de einige Tipps bekommen, die ich nun weiter verfolge. Wenn alles klappt, dann dokumentiere ich das hier.

    Piet
    Mein Motto: Hilf Deinen Kunden zu wachsen, dann wächst auch Du.
    Bei Interesse: Piet ist zu finden unter Webdesign-NRW.de

  3. #3
    Contao-Nutzer Avatar von Piet
    Registriert seit
    25.06.2009.
    Ort
    Bergisches Land
    Beiträge
    122
    Partner-ID
    ex5879

    Standard

    Ich habe nun einige Versuche durchgeführt und möchte anderen diese ersparen.

    Also die Buttons und Selects usw. werden als VARCHAR oder INT in der DB abgelegt, entsprechend dem, was ihr bei den Werten eintragt. Nutzt ihr dort nur Zahlenwerte ohne Nachkommastellen nehmt INT, sonst FLOAT. Wenn etwas anderes drinsteht als Zahlen, dann in der DB VARCHAR anlegen.

    Als Besonderheit empfinde ich das Kalenderfeld. Auch hier muss in der DB VARCHAR angelegt sein, alle Versuche dort mit DATE oder TIMEDATE zu arbeiten, schlugen fehl. Es wird zwar etwas eingetragen, aber leider grottenfalsch. Zumindest bei uns im deutschen Sprachraum mit unserer Repräsentation des Datums.

    Alles Gute
    Piet
    Mein Motto: Hilf Deinen Kunden zu wachsen, dann wächst auch Du.
    Bei Interesse: Piet ist zu finden unter Webdesign-NRW.de

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•